## Deployment

VramScope ships as a sidecar. Deploy it with the target workload, same node, same GPU visibility. Profiling hooks inject at container start; restarting the workload mid-profile loses the sample buffer. Release builds must pin the collector version to the driver ABI listed in the compat matrix. No hot-reload — config changes require a sidecar restart. The release configuration is as follows.

deployment values, fadug-bawif:
SORWYN_LOG_LEVEL=debug
SORWYN_METRICS_HOST=metrics.sorwyn.qirvansys.internal
SORWYN_POOL_SIZE=32

**Audit checklist — item 7: Hermetic build migration (Kilnworks)**

Quick one for the release manager before we cut 4.2: confirm the Kilnworks pipeline is fully hermetic. That means no build step reaching the network, all toolchains pinned in the lockfile, and the two legacy scripts that used to pull assets from the shared drive are gone (they should be, but please double-check — they've snuck back in twice). If anything fails, don't waive it; hermetic builds are a hard gate this cycle. Flag any exception to the owner of record, listed below.

named custodian: Brivan Eliath Quenox Frador

Step 4: Deploying the Cutoff Service for Marrowbread Bakery. The order-cutoff rule (no custom cake orders after 14:00 local) is enforced server-side in the cutoff-gate module; verify the config checksum before promotion. The release bundle must be signed prior to upload to the Ovenline registry. Use the signing key shown directly below this step.

rollout seal: bky9_PeXH1fTLY